Market Overview:
The global online banks market is expected to grow at a CAGR of over 16% during the forecast period from 2018 to 2030. The growth in this market can be attributed to the increasing demand for online banking services from individual consumers and enterprise users. In addition, the growing adoption of mobile banking and cloud-based banking solutions is also contributing to the growth of this market. The global online banks market can be segmented on the basis of type into those with their own bank licence and those that are partnered with other banks. The former segment is expected to account for a larger share of the global online banks market than the latter during the forecast period. This can be attributed to factors such as ease of use and convenience offered by these banks, which has led to an increase in their adoption among consumers worldwide. On the basis of application,the global online banksmarket can be divided into individual consumersand enterprise users.
Product Definition:
An online bank is a bank where customers can conduct their banking transactions over the internet. Online banks offer their customers the convenience of banking from home or work, without having to go to a physical bank location.
The importance of online banks is that they offer customers more convenience and flexibility than traditional brick-and-mortar banks. Customers can access their accounts 24/7, and can do most of their banking transactions (such as checking account balances, transferring money between accounts, and paying bills) without having to leave home. Additionally, many online banks offer competitive interest rates on deposits and low or no fees on certain transactions.
